Animation World Magazine, Issue 3.4, July 1998
LicensingLicensing Show News. The annual Licensing Show took place at the Jacob K. Javitz Convention Center in New York City, June 9-11. It is here that producers of animated properties made deals with licensees to create toys, games, software, apparel and other products based on their characters. Some news was: Canadian company NELVANA is lining up licensees for its six new animated series to air on CBS in fall 1998. Franklin will be featured in a promotion of Polygram home videos and Eden plush toys at the U.S. chain of stores called Zany Brainy. From the Files of the Flying Rhinoceros will be featured on posters with the U.S. Postal Service and as a new ice cream flavor from Baskin Robbins. . . . Saban/Fox Kids signed Parachute Publishing and HarperCollins to create a series of children's books based on the Life With Louie series. . . . Nickelodeon recently struck a promotional deal with Campbell's Soup to tie in with Rugrats and Blue's Clues. . . . Australian company Southern Star is handling licensing for Cosgrove Hall and ITEL's stop-motion animated series The Animal Shelf. Ladybird Books has signed on for story and activity books, and Bluebird Toys has developed a plush line.
Also during the Licensing Show, the International Licensing Industry Merchandisers' Association (LIMA) presented its annual LIMA awards on June 10. The animated-related winners are:
Licensing Agency of the Year and License of the Year: Nickelodeon's Rugrats.
Licensee of the Year/Soft Goods: Happy Kids for Rugrats children's apparel.
License of the Year (worldwide outside the U.S.): Warner Bros. Consumer Products Looney Tunes property.
